New play equipment and outdoor gym to transform Hemswell Cliff

20/03/2026

The ‘Make Hemswell Cliff Glitter’ campaign is bringing exciting new outdoor facilities to the community this summer.

Children in Hemswell Cliff are set to benefit from new play equipment, while adults will soon be able to enjoy an outdoor gym, as part of an ambitious community improvement project.

The developments form part of Make Hemswell Cliff Glitter—a campaign named by local children—which aims to deliver a range of enhancements across the former RAF base.

The new play facilities have been made possible through a £100,000 grant from FCC Communities Foundation, alongside £20,000 from the National Lottery Community Fund and £10,750 from West Lindsey District Council. The funding will support the purchase and installation of modern play equipment at Capper Avenue and Minden Place.

The wider project has been led by Hemswell Cliff Parish Council, which has also been progressing plans for a new outdoor gym. Part-funded by the council and supported by contributions from local businesses, the gym is expected to be installed at the same time as the play area, with both set to take shape by the end of June.
